Hi all,

I am looking into a Pte John Bernard Clark 31048 East Yorkshire Regiment, KIA with 10th Bn 29/9/1918 on behalf of his grandson and was looking for the Dinsdale list online but couldn't find it anymore?

Does anyone have any info on this guy?

- Medal Index Card British War Medal & Victory Medal

– Accidentally injured by an explosion of a mobile charge in 1st Battalion East Yorkshire Regiment A Coy Cook-house 22 February 1917

- Also served 12th and 1st Battalions East Yorkshire Regiment
